Highnstein Day 1 – 05.05.2025 / 21:20 – Planted Yesterday, my MarsHydro tent and equipment finally arrived. Around 9:30 PM, I planted the Papaya Cookies seeds directly into the BioBizz Light Mix soil. I might have overwatered a bit — I poured about 1.3L of water into each pot, which could slow down germination. After planting, I covered the soil with clear plastic cups to maintain humidity. I sprayed the inside of the cups with water to help keep moisture levels up. The grow light is currently set to 25% power. This is my first grow ever, so I'm hoping for the best. If anyone reading this has tips or advice, I'm all ears! Day 2 – 06.05.2025 / 7:00 – Humidity at 99%, temperature 24°C (Turned on ventilation) Day 3 – 07.05.2025 / 17:57 – Humidity 85%, temperature 25°C – No signs of sprouting yet Day 4 – 08.05.2025 / 19:05 – The smallest one in the bottom left has sprouted and is already above soil. In the big pot next to it, the seed is visible at the surface but hasn’t emerged yet. The other two show no signs yet. Humidity lowered to 60–70% Temperature 25°C Day 5 – 09.05.2025 / 7:00 – Three have sprouted. The smallest one is holding up well, the stem has grown a bit. The one on the right has come out but still has the seed shell on its head (I'll check when I get home, maybe remove it manually?). The third one at the top has come out and looks healthy. Temperature: 24.6°C Humidity: 60% // 17:00 – Increased light intensity, humidity back to 70% Day 6 – 10.05.2025 / 10:40 – All four have sprouted. Two still have their seed shells (I removed one manually). Soil feels a bit dry, I’ll add about 150ml of water around each. I’ll transplant the smallest one into a big pot and add soil. Lowered humidity from 80% to about 60% (waiting to see where it stabilizes - looking for 70%). Dropped the light lower and increased to 40% power. Day 7 - 11/05/2025 / 10:00 Temperature dropped to 21°C, 50% humidity. Reduced fan speed — hoping things improve by the afternoon. All plants look fine.

Highnstein Day 8 - 12/05/2025 / 7:00 Temperature 26°C, humidity 80% (trying to reduce it to 70%). They look healthy and are growing. One still has the seed shell on — tried removing it with tweezers but didn’t work. Will try again when I get home. 21:05 – Humidity 70%, temp 27°C. Increased light intensity to 75% and turned on the fan to bring humidity down to 60%. Will check in the morning. All look healthy, no need to water. Day 9 - 13/05/2025 / 7:10 Everything looks healthy and bigger. Temp 26°C, humidity 53%. Soil felt dry, so I watered. (Humidity will hopefully rise back to 60%) 20:00 – Lowered the light height, kept intensity at 75%. No need to water. Humidity jumped to 70%, turned the fan back on to lower it to desired 60%. Day 10 - 14/05/2025 / 7:00 Everything looked okay, maybe a little dry — will water after work. Temp 26°C, humidity 54%. By evening, humidity increased to 70% and temp to 27°C. Day 11 - 15/05/2025 / 7:00 All looks okay. Two plants are slightly bent — lowered the light even more. Humidity 70%, temp 27°C. In the evening, one was leaning over — supported it with two sticks and it’s upright again. Moved the fan higher so it blows across all the plants. Day 12 - 16/05/2025 / 7:00 Everything looks good. Temp and humidity are spot on. 19:20 – Looked a bit dry, so I increased the watering dose. The drooping one drooped again, added support again. Leaves look wavy? Not sure why. Day 13 - 17/05/2025 All good. Watered two, the other two were still moist. Day 14 - 18/05/2025 Nothing unusual. Watered all four. Will check again in the evening. Growing faster every day. 21:00 - All good. Stable temperature and humidity.

Highnstein This week showed strong growth across all four plants. I began feeding with BioBizz Grow early in the week, and by the end, introduced Bloom and Top Max as well. Watering was done as needed — typically around 0.5 to 1 liter per plant — alternating between plain water and nutrient mixes. I also started low stress training (LST) on all plants, and they responded well. Humidity was the main issue throughout the week, often reaching 70%. I increased exhaust fan speed, aired out the grow tent, and placed a dehumidifier outside the tent to manage it. While this helped temporarily, humidity levels remain a challenge. Temperature stayed in a good range, and light intensity was increased to 100% with the fixture lowered closer to the canopy by the end of the week. Overall, the plants are looking healthy and strong, with steady progress despite the ongoing battle with high humidity.

Highnstein The plants continued to grow well and appear healthy overall. This week, I switched the light cycle to 18/6, and growth remained steady across most plants — although one smaller plant is still lagging, likely due to being in different soil. Watering was done regularly, with each plant receiving between 1 and 1.5 liters, alternating between plain water and nutrient mixes (1,5 ml of each BioBizz nutrient per liter on Day 26). Humidity remained a consistent issue, often spiking to 67–70%. I managed it by increasing exhaust fan speed, opening the window, and using the dehumidifier more aggressively, including overnight. By the end of the week, humidity levels improved, dropping to 55–60%, with temperatures stable around 24–27°C. Overall, the grow tent environment is becoming more balanced, and the plants are responding positively to the care and adjustments.

Highnstein The plants are progressing well and showing steady, healthy growth. Environmental conditions have improved this week — humidity has stayed consistently lower, ranging from 45% to 52%, and temperature has been maintained between 26°C and 28.7°C, with some effort to bring it down closer to 26°C for optimal conditions. Watering was done every few days, typically 1.5 liters per plant, and nutrient feeding was included on Days 30 and 34. The plants appear to be responding positively, with no visible issues. Overall, this week marked a stable phase in the grow, with balanced conditions and healthy development.
